WebApr 9, 2024 · Getting green hair from pool water is often blamed on chlorine, but there is a little more to the story. Green hair is actually caused by a chemical reaction between copper, chlorine, and protein. When the copper concentration in your water is > 2ppm the copper ions can be oxidized when a large dose of chlorine is added. WebThe copper will then turn a green color and cling to your hair. If you never shock your pool or keep your pH levels in complete control then you will not have green hair, but as soon as you start to increase other levels the results due to high copper in the water will turn your hair green again.
